About Rage of the Abyss

Rage of the Abyss is a Yu-Gi-Oh set released on 2024-10-11, currently valued at $1,405 in total market value. This set contains 135 tracked cards.

The most valuable card in Rage of the Abyss is Mulcharmy Fuwalos (Quarter Century Secret Rare) at $340.02, followed by Dominus Impulse (Quarter Century Secret Rare) ($156.41) and Ultimate Dragon of Pride and Soul ($93.60). Together, the top 3 cards represent 42% of the set's total value.

Over the past week, Rage of the Abyss has declined 2.1% in value, with a -2.5% change over 30 days and -7.2% over 90 days.
